The car listed above is a ST model with a 1.6 EcoBoost.

When the engine is hot after a rev in neutral the RPMs drop very slowly, they even stuck around 2,000 RPMs for some seconds (while the foot is completely off the gas pedal).

Yep, this can happen when the turbo is leaking internally. I other words the exhaust gases are getting into the intake, or you have a vacuum leak, let follow these two guides to find the leak or the reason for the high idle.

Can I ask if you have a check engine light on? If so, we should run the codes. also did you notice if the engine is down on power? If so, this can be a sign the turbo is bad. If you can remove the intake or exhaust side of the turbo to check the main shaft endplay. Please go over these guides and get back to us.

i had a check engine light: "P2187: System too lean at idle".

I don't really think the engine is down on power, but it could be, i don't really have the tools to check the turbo since it is not a really easy access...

i would love to check for vacuum leaks but I don't really have a smoke machine, i saw that it can be done with soapy water too but unfortunately i don't really know where the vacuum lines are and where should I spray the water? can you guys help me out by indicating them for me?

Yep, it seems like you have a vacuum leak. I would use a smoke machine because it is difficult to find the leak on a turbo engine. I would inspect the turbo tubes and look for cracks or tears, the smoke machine is $70.00 on Amazon. Go back to the video and there will be a link. Let me know what happens.
